QoE measurement of multi-view glassless 3DTV by information integration of biometric measurement and brain function measurement

In general, image quality assessment is using a questionnaire. In order to better this methods, we are trying to use the biological information in image quality assessment. We researched influence of cerebral blood flow on image quality by NIRS (Near-infrared spectroscopy). As a result, we found the effect that oxy-Hb in frontal lobe was increased when the subject is watching a moving image. Moreover, the effect was higher when the image quality is degraded.Next, we conduct the experiment which measures change of facial muscles by the consciousness of coding degradation. In the experiment, when the image quality was changed, the increase in eye-line activity was observed in the muscles around eyes. It was shown that change of image quality can be presumed from eye-line activity.
